About the accommodation
Mantra on Russell is within close proximity to all of Melbourne's premium attractions including boutique shopping, famous eat streets and a superb array of cafes and bars, theaters, sporting venues and cultural experiences. Offering studio and apartment-style rooms all featuring air-conditioning, fully-equipped kitchens, bathrooms, laundry facilities and most apartments also have a private balcony (please request).
Read more